Cannot access website due to invalid certificate

I cannot access The Guardian UK website from my MacBook (Sierra OSX) using Chrome, Safari or Neon browsers. The Safari pop up simply tells me the Guardian certificate "has an invalid user".

The Neon browser pop up is more informative (see below) but scary!

I am using WiFi and tried at both home and work WiFi connections - I get the same message.

From my work iMac I can access the website no problem at all.

So ... is there some malware on my MacBook I need to remove? A certificate in Keychain?

Or another solution?


This is only happening at the guardian.co.uk website though.

Scam pop-up


1. Click  in the menu bar and choose “Force Quit”.

In the window that opens up, select “Safari” and click “Force Quit.

2. Relaunch Safari holding the shift key down.


Adware

3. Use Malwarebytes Anti-Malware for Mac to remove adware.


https://www.malwarebytes.org/antimalware/mac/

Download, install , open, and run it by clicking “Scan” button to remove adware.

Once done, quit Malwarebytes Anti-Malware for Mac.


4. Disable Extensions and test.

Safari > Preferences > Extensions

Select and disable all extensions and test.

Enable Extensions one by one and test.

To uninstall any extension, select it and click the “Uninstall” button.


5. Safari > Preferences > Search > Search engine:

Select your preferred search engine.


6. Visit the site you want it to be the Home page

Safari > Preferences > General > Homepage

Click the button “Set to Current Page” button.

7. Restart the Mac.
